Sign up freeValentine Brown 1816 – 1900 – Genealogical Records
Birth Date: 2 Jan 1816
Birth Location: Baveria, Germany
Death Date: 24 Feb 1900
Death Location: Tuscarawas, Tuscarawas, Ohio, United States
Father: Christian Braun
Mother: Philipina Braun
Spouse(s): SUSANNA STEINER
Children(s): Jacob Brown, Pheobe Brown, George Brown, Louisa Brown, David Brown
The story of Valentine Brown began in 1816 in Baveria, Germany. Valentine Brown married SUSANNA LOUISA CATHARINA STEINER, and had children including Jacob Brown, Pheobe Brown, George Brown, Louisa Brown, David Brown. Valentine Brown passed away in 1900 in Tuscarawas, Tuscarawas, Ohio, United States.
